Peruvian Andes

Range TypePolitically-defined sub-range
Highest PointNevado Huascarán (6768 m/22,205 ft)
CountriesPeru
States/ProvincesCuzco (9%), Arequipa (8%), Puno (8%), San Martín (7%), Loreto (6%), Junín (6%), Ayacucho (6%), Huánuco (5%), Ancash (5%), Lima Region (5%), Cajamarca (4%), Ucayali (3%), La Libertad (3%), Madre de Dios (3%), Huancavelica (3%), Pasco (3%), Amazonas (3%), Apurímac (3%), Moquegua (2%), Piura (2%), Tacna (2%), Ica (2%), Lambayeque (1%)
(numbers are approximate percentage of range area)
Area760,164 sq km / 293,500 sq mi
Area may include lowland areas
Extent1,574 km / 978 mi North-South
1,296 km / 805 mi East-West
Center Lat/Long11° 22' S; 74° 39' W

Major Peaks of the Peruvian Andes

Ten Highest Peaks
RankPeak NamemftRange4
1.Nevado Huascarán676822,205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
2.Nevado Yerupajá661721,709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
3.Nevado Coropuna640521,014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
4.Nevado Huandoy639520,981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
5.Nevado Corpuna - Casulla637720,922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
6.Nevado Ausangate637220,906Cordillera Oriental (Peru)
7.Nevado Huantsan636920,896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
8.Nevado Chopicalqui635420,846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
9.Siula Grande634420,814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
10.Nevado Coropuna - Pico Este630520,686Cordillera Occidental (Peru)
Sub-peaks are excluded from this list. List may not be complete, since only summits in the PBC Database are included.
